Perisic To Be Sacrificed For FFP In Worst Case Scenario

There  are four players who would bring in enough capital gains to solve Financial Fair Play: Skriniar, Brozovic, Perisic and Icardi. Tuttosport believe that Perisic is the most likely to be sacrificed if Inter can’t find the money elsewhere.

“Skriniar has already confirmed that he does not want to leave and Inter are unwilling to listen to any offers unless the start at 75-80 million euros, while Icardi is worth 110 million until July 15th: if someone abroad pays it and he says yes, there is little Inter can do, but they will be hoping it doesn’t happen because the loss of their captain would be difficult to replace. Spalletti was able to transform Brozovic into the perfect regista for his Inter and does not want to risk finding another one. He has a 50 million release clause, which many consider to be too high. Therefore, it is Perisic who could be sacrificed, because Inter are looking to bring in a new pair of wingers (Politano, Marlos and Malcom) and still has Candreva (renewal until 2021) and Karamoh”.

According to the Turin newspaper, the number 44 is the number 1 suspect to leave Milan for the balance sheet, which is currently 8 million into the positives so an offer of 40 million for the Croatian would fully achieve their settlement agreement? But will it become necessary?
